Why is this role important?

The Transformation Project Manager leads the delivery of strategic transformation projects that advance CIHI’s organizational priorities. This role is responsible for developing and managing detailed project plans, budgets, schedules, resources, risks, and stakeholder engagement. Beyond core project delivery, the Transformation Project Manager supports alignment between strategy and execution, ensuring projects deliver measurable value and sustainable change.
Working within the Transformation Office, this role partners with business and technical leaders to shape initiatives, navigate complexity and enable cross-functional collaboration. The Transformation Project Manager emphasizes outcomes over outputs, integrating change management, agile delivery and continuous improvement practices to support successful adoption and long-term impact.
This posting will be used to staff three contract positions: one fixed-term contract ending March 31, 2027, and two one-year contracts.

What you'll do

1. Develop and maintain project charters, detailed plans, and implementation activities in alignment with CIHI’s project management standards.
2. Lead the development and integration of benefits realization and change management plans, ensuring project outcomes are aligned with strategic objectives, and measurable value is delivered post-implementation.
3. Lead project life cycle activities including initiation, planning, execution, monitoring, controlling, and closing.
4. Manage project scope, schedule, budget, resources, risks, and issues; implement mitigation and corrective actions as needed.
5. Liaise with functional authorities to secure technical, business, and corporate support resources.
6. Facilitate cross-functional collaboration across a matrix environment, ensuring timely resolution of outstanding issues.
7. Monitor and report on project health and progress, using data to inform decision-making and course corrections.
8. Foster a culture of continuous improvement by capturing insights, lessons learned across projects.
9. Contribute to portfolio-level planning and prioritization, supporting sequencing, dependency management and optimization of organizational capacity.
10. Act as a project management ambassador, contributing to the evolution of project management discipline and training within the organization.
11. Coach and support teams in modern delivery approaches, including Agile, iterative delivery and outcome-based planning.
